How do I answer someone’s message saying I hope all is well with you?

When someone says ‘I hope all is well with you’, this a respectful sign showing genuine care and regard. In this case it would be best to reciprocate what the other person has said, to show that you accept their sentiments. You could reply by saying, ‘I hope all is well with you too, thank you for asking! ‘.

Can I say going good?

You can’t say going good. Well is an adverb and describes how I’m doing and how I’m going.

How is life at your end?

The correct expression is “How are things going at your end?”, or just “how are things at your end?”. It is simply asking how a person is when the person is away from the speaker – either talking on the phone or over the internet. ‘At your end’ means ‘where you are.

Is everything fine at your end?

The fixed expression, ‘I hope everything is fine at your end’ is commonly featured in letter-writing. A fixed expression is a variety of sentences or phrases that has meaning more specific than the words it uses. For instance, the greeting, “How do you do?” doesn’t actually imply how one does something.

Is it correct to say’i hope everything would be fine’?

We can say, “I hope everything will be fine,” or “I hope everything is fine.” If you are referring to yourself in the past, you can say, “I hoped everything would be fine,” or “I hoped everything was fine.” When we use will/would, our sentences are conditional; what we hope has not happened yet.

Why do people say I hope you are doing well in email?

Anyone who gets a lot of email is familiar with the classic “I hope you’re doing well” and its related family of phrases. It’s the email equivalent of small talk. And like small talk, this phrase can get a little repetitive if you find yourself relying on it too often.
